The correct answer is based on the functionalities and supported technologies of Dynatrace OneAgent. OneAgent is designed to monitor a wide array of applications and services, providing detailed insights into their performance and health. The extensions available for OneAgent enhance its capabilities by enabling it to capture and analyze metrics from specific technologies.

The extension for MongoDB is used for monitoring MongoDB databases, including performance metrics regarding operations and resource utilization. The ActiveMQ extension allows for monitoring message queue performance, thereby ensuring that messages are processed efficiently. The CouchDB extension provides similar insights for this NoSQL database.
